Lisa Lavon Klein, 64, of Indianapolis, formerly of Montana, passed away on November 7, 2024.
Lisa was born on September 17, 1958, in Montana, to Gary Gene and Carla Faye (Strader) Fesler. Lisa was the embodiment of tough, unafraid of confrontation, and a battleaxe in the best sense of the word. She was a big fan of all things supernatural, especially the show Supernatural, magic, and she had a lasting love for dragons. Back in the ’80s, she was even a member of a Stephen King book club.
Lisa was a talented artist with a knack for drawing, painting, and pastels, a gift she passed on to her son whom is also a very talented artist in his choice of medium. She loved being a Granny and being a grandmother was her favorite thing. She will be missed.
Lisa is survived by her son, Joseph Klein, and his wife, Jennifer; her grandchildren; and several great-grandchildren.
She was preceded in passing by her parents, Gary and Carla Fesler; her husband, Michael Clifford Klein; and two brothers and one sister.
